# Greywharf Environments: `resizely` batch image CLI

The `resizely` CLI runs in three environments — dev, staging, and prod — each with its own object-store bucket and worker concurrency limits. New team members should note that staging shares prod's source bucket in read-only mode, so test writes land elsewhere. Each environment loads its settings at startup; the staging environment currently uses the following values.

deployment values, yadug-bawif:
[framir]
team = pelox
access_code = ac_a38ab2
owner = tamion.julael
host = framir.tolvaqlabs.test
port = 11211
peer = tammir.zemvargrid.local
salt = 2215ef03
pin = 1541

Refactors the legacy Quillbase ORM layer in `ordersvc`. Removes the hand-rolled identity map, replaces lazy-load proxies with explicit fetch plans, and drops the reflection-based column mapper. No schema changes. Behavior parity verified against the Harrowfield replay corpus; diffs were zero across 1.2M rows. Rollback is a straight revert — no migrations ship with this PR. On-call: batch sizes and connection ceilings changed, so watch pool saturation on the first deploy. The new tuning constants are as follows.

tuning table, kajog-kawef:
PRIORITIES = {
    "kelox": 870,
    "kasix": 89,
    "eliax": 988,
}

**Vendor note: Inkmill markdown pipeline**

Rendering for Parchway docs is outsourced to Inkmill under an annual contract, renewing each March. They handle sanitization and PDF export; we own the upload queue. SLA: 4-hour response on rendering failures. Escalate only after two failed retries. Their support desk is reachable at the address below.

billing contact of hahaf-baguf = zorael.tammir.jorius@sivrelhq.internal